What is your typical day like?
I start my day around 6:30am when my husband wakes me up as he gets ready for work. I start my day by reviewing and responding on my email and social media outlets. Depending on the day, I like to add inspirational posts in my Instagram stories for all those fellow entrepreneurs waking up for the day. Once the posts and replies are done, I get breakfast for myself, take my dog out, and prep for the day’s meetings.
A typical day involves visiting vendors to discuss my client’s events. For instance, visiting the florist to review the floral design with my clients. We normally visit 2-3 florists to see who is the best fit. After that, I normally head to my favorite restaurant, Red Fox, located in Middletown, CT for lunch. After lunch, I go back to my office to respond to emails, work on event details, and continue with more meetings.
After my work day, my husband and I enjoy hanging out, eating dinner, and watching our favorite shows together.
How did you get started in the industry?
I started working in the restaurant industry at 16 and fell in love with it! I decided to go to school for hospitality and continued my career in the hotel industry at 19 after graduating.
I have worked for major companies such as Hilton, Bertucci’s, Panera, and Nordstrom which has helped me to grow my craft by being in all different settings and working with different types of clientele and events. Panera had a wonderful training program and Nordstrom works hard to never say no to a client which is very important in selling to them. You always find a way to help someone who is interested in a service.
I went to school for Hospitality with a minor in Hotel/Restaurant Management. After working in multiple settings doing weddings/events and helping people, I asked myself why am I not doing this for myself? After working for such influential companies, I had so much knowledge. It made sense to share it with clients in need of a wedding planner who could help them plan their perfect day.
